Postgresql与Oracle语法区别

PostgreSql

    • 一、Pg数据库相比较于Oracle数据库有什么优势?
    • 二、事务
    • 三、子查询
    • 四、数据类型
    • 五、分页
    • 六、部分函数差异
    • 七、游标
    • 八、存储过程和函数
    • 九、declare/begin/end代码块
    • 十、执行顺序
    • 十一、字符串拼接
    • 十二、打印

一、Pg数据库相比较于Oracle数据库有什么优势?

  • PostgreSql是目前功能最强大的开源数据库
  • 稳定可靠:PostgreSql在主备库方面非常完善,可以搭建同步备库、异步备库、延迟备库,在同步备库中可以同时配置数据同步到任意备库上;且在配置备库过程中比Oracle更加简单;此外PostgreSql是唯一能做到数据零丢失的开源数据库,目前有报道称国内外有部分银行使用PostgreSql数据库
  • 开源省钱:免费的、开源的,而且使用的是类BSD协议,在使用和二次开发上基本没有限制
  • 有更多支持互联网特征的功能,如数据类型支持网络地址类型、XML类型、JSON类型、UUID类型以及数组类型,且有强大的正则表达式函数;且支持大量主流的开发语言,包括C、C

你可能感兴趣的:(数据库开发,postgresql,oracle,数据库)